              Bolsa is the Beretta authorized shop because when the Olympics were in LA, Fred let them use his shop for any repairs or adjustments when no other shops would. So he got rewarded with the authorization. Several years ago, my younger brother worked there. He did a lot of rifle and shotgun work, building some very accurate rifles...for which Fred took credit. At that time, they were mainly parts replacers except for favored or high end customers. They did not want to work on older firearms where parts had to be made, which Randy was capable of, because something else would fail and they would get the blame, in Fred's opinion, and it would end up being a never-ending stream of repairs to be done cheaply as the issue was "Bolsa's fault." Fred did do excellent wood work and refinishing/polishing. Randy did all the blueing and lathe work. When he left, Keith, another friend of mine had to go in and show them how to work their older lathe.
              From what I understand, Fred's son-in-law, Jason is now pretty much running things and they have gotten better in many ways and more consistent. I cannot speak to their current service level.
